Congressman Castro Announces $1.3 Million in Security Grants for Charitable and Faith-Based Organizations Serving San Antonio

SAN ANTONIO – Today, Congressman Joaquin Castro (TX-20) announced $1,344,979 in federal funding to help San Antonio-area nonprofits and faith-based organizations prevent and protect against terrorist threats and attacks. These federal funds, awarded through the Federal Emergency Management Agency’s Nonprofit Security Grant Program, provide financial assistance for local charitable and faith-based organizations to enhance security measures, including alarm systems, security guards, training, and other emergency preparedness planning.

“Across the country, including in Texas, we have seen a rise in violent, hate-driven threats and attacks,” said Congressman Castro. “This grant funding will help equip San Antonio organizations and places of worship with the necessary enhancements to safely serve our community. I will continue working with the federal government to bring federal resources home and keep San Antonians safe.”
